What is a Sauna 3D Configurator?

A sauna 3D configurator is an interactive digital tool that allows users to design their saunas with precision and creativity. By leveraging advanced 3D modeling technology, these configurators enable users to select various options such as sauna size, shape, materials, and additional features. This visual approach not only enhances the design experience but also helps potential buyers to make informed decisions before making a purchase.

Key Features of Sauna 3D Configurator Tools

  • Interactive Design: Users can manipulate the dimensions and features of their sauna in real-time, allowing for a custom fit in any space.
  • Material Selection: Configurators often come with a wide range of wood options, finishes, and accessories, providing flexibility in aesthetic choices.
  • Visual Rendering: High-quality graphics allow users to visualize their sauna from different angles, ensuring that every detail meets their vision.
  • Cost Estimation: Many configurators include cost calculators that provide estimates based on the selected materials and features, helping users stay within budget.
  • Print and Share Options: Users can save their designs and share them with friends or family for feedback, or print them out for reference.

Types of Saunas Available

There are various types of saunas, each offering distinct benefits. The most common include:

  • Traditional Finnish Saunas: These use dry heat and are typically constructed from wood, providing a classic sauna experience.
  • Infrared Saunas: Using infrared panels, these saunas heat the body directly rather than the air, offering potential health benefits at lower temperatures.
  • Steam Saunas: Also known as steam rooms, these operate at high humidity and lower temperatures, ideal for individuals who prefer a moist environment.
  • Outdoor Saunas: These are designed for external installation, often made from weather-resistant materials, providing a unique experience surrounded by nature.

How to Consider Space Limitations

Before diving too deeply into design, it’s essential to assess the available space for your sauna. Accurate measurements are critical in ensuring that your sauna fits seamlessly into your intended location. The configurator aids in simulating various layouts, allowing users to experiment with different sizes and placements to optimize their space. Take into account ceiling height, proximity to plumbing for steam models, and ventilation requirements when planning your sauna’s design.

Common Mistakes to Avoid

While designing your sauna, avoid these common pitfalls:

  • Not measuring your space accurately, leading to a sauna that doesn’t fit.
  • Choosing materials without considering maintenance and durability.
  • Overlooking important features like ventilation and lighting.
  • Failing to consider heating and power supply requirements.
